Java程式設計那些事兒11——JDK的獲得、安裝和配置
阿新 • • 發佈:2019-02-14
Java程式設計那些事兒11——JDK的安裝、配置和使用
作者:陳躍峰
第二章 建立開發環境
“工欲善其事,必先利其器”。
進行程式開發,首先要安裝開發相關的軟體,並且熟悉這些工具軟體的基本使用。本章介紹一下兩類開發工具的使用:
l基礎開發工具
基礎開發工具是進行程式設計的基礎,包含開發中需要的一些基本功能,例如編譯、執行等,是其它開發工具的基礎。
Java語言的基本開發工具是SUN公司免費提供的JDK。
實際開發中,為了方便和程式開發的效率,一般不直接使用基礎開發工具,所以對於很多基礎開發工具,只需要掌握其基本的使用即可。
l整合開發環境(IDE)
整合開發環境是指將程式設計需要的很多功能,例如程式碼編輯、程式碼除錯、程式部署等等一系列功能都整合到一個程式內部,方便程式開發,並提高實際的開發效率,簡化了程式設計中的很多操作。
Java語言的整合開發環境很多,常見的有Eclipse、JBuilder、NetBeans等等。
由於實際開發中,基本都是使用整合開發環境進行開發,所以在學習中必須熟練掌握該類工具的使用。
一般整合開發環境的使用都很類似,在學習時只要熟練掌握了其中一個的使用,其它的工具學習起來也很簡單。
本文以Eclipse為例來介紹整合開發環境的基本使用。
2.1 JDK開發環境
JDK(Java Developer’s Kit),Java開發者工具包,也稱J2SDK(Java 2 Software Development Kit),是SUN公司提供的基礎Java語言開發工具,該工具軟體包含Java語言的編譯工具、執行工具以及執行程式的環境(即JRE)。
JDK現在是一個開源、免費的工具。
JDK是其它Java開發工具的基礎,也就是說,在安裝其它開發工具以前,必須首先安裝JDK。
對於初學者來說,使用該開發工具進行學習,可以在學習的初期把精力放在Java語言語法的學習上,體會更多底層的知識,對於以後的程式開發很有幫助。
但是JDK未提供Java原始碼的編寫環境,這個是SUN提供的很多基礎開發工具的通病,所以實際的程式碼編寫還需要在其它的文字編輯器中進行。其實大部分程式設計語言的原始碼都是一個文字檔案,只是儲存成了不同的字尾名罷了。
常見的適合Java的文字編輯器有很多,例如JCreator、Editplus、UltraEdit等。
下面依次來介紹JDK的下載、安裝、配置和使用。
2.1.1 JDK的獲得
如果需要獲得最新版本的JDK,可以到SUN公司的官方網站上進行下載,下載地址為:
下載最新版本的“JDK 6 Update 6”,選擇對應的作業系統,以及使用的語言即可。
在下載Windows版本時,有兩個版本可供下載,,分別是:
lWindows Online Installation
線上安裝版本,每次安裝時都從網路上下載安裝程式,在下載完成以後,進行實際的安裝。
lWindows Offline Installation
離線安裝版本,每次安裝時直接進行本地安裝。
通常情況下,一般下載離線安裝版本。
其實如果不需要安裝最新版本的話,也可以在國內主流的下載站點下載JDK的安裝程式,只是這些程式的版本可能稍微老一些,這些對於初學者來說其實問題不大。
2.1.2 JDK的安裝
Windows作業系統上的JDK安裝程式是一個exe可執行程式,直接安裝即可,在安裝過程中可以選擇安裝路徑以及安裝的元件等,如果沒有特殊要求,選擇預設設定即可。程式預設的安裝路徑在C:\Program Files\Java目錄下。
2.1.3 JDK的配置
JDK安裝完成以後,可以不用設定就進行使用,但是為了使用方便,一般需要進行簡單的配置。
由於JDK提供的編譯和執行工具都是基於命令列的,所以需要進行一下DOS下面的一個設定,把JDK安裝目錄下bin目錄中的可執行檔案都新增到DOS的外部命令中,這樣就可以在任意路徑下直接使用bin目錄下的exe程式了。
配置的引數為作業系統中的path環境變數,該變數的用途是系統查詢可執行程式所在的路徑。
配置步驟為:
1、“開始”>“設定”>“控制面板”>“系統”
如果控制面板的設定不是經典方式,那麼可以在控制面板的“效能和維護”中找到“系統”。
當然,也可以選擇桌面上的“我的電腦”,點選滑鼠右鍵,選擇“屬性”開啟。
2、在“系統屬性”視窗中,選擇“高階”屬性頁中的“環境變數”按鈕。
3、在“環境變數”視窗中,選擇“系統變數”中變數名為“Path”的環境變數,雙擊該變數。
4、把JDK安裝路徑中bin目錄的絕對路徑,新增到Path變數的值中,並使用半形的分號和已有的路徑進行分隔。
例如JDK的安裝路徑下的bin路徑是C:\Program Files\Java\jdk1.6.0_04\bin,則把該路徑新增到Path值的起始位置,則值為:C:\Program Files\Java\jdk1.6.0_04\bin;C:\Program Files\PC Connectivity Solution\;C:\Program Files\Java\jdk1.6.0_04\bin;C:\j2sdk1.4.2_11\bin;%SystemRoot%\system32;%SystemRoot%;%SystemRoot%\System32\Wbem
以上路徑在不同的計算機中可能不同。
配置完成以後,可以使用如下格式來測試配置是否成功:
1、開啟“開始”>“程式”>“附件”>“命令提示符”
2、在“命令提示符”視窗中,輸入javac,按回車執行
如果輸出的內容是使用說明,則說明配置成功。
如果輸出的內容是“’javac’不是內部或外部命令,也不是可執行的程式或批處理檔案。”,則說明配置錯誤,需要重新進行配置。
常見的配置錯誤為:
1)路徑錯誤,路徑應該類似C:\Program Files\Java\jdk1.6.0_04\bin。
2)分隔的分號錯誤,例如錯誤的打成冒號或使用全形的分號。